§ 6-704.1. Certification renewal requirement for school counselors.

Universal Citation: MD Educ Code § 6-704.1 (2018)
  • (a) In general. -- On or before July 1, 2016, the Board shall require a certificate holder applying for renewal of a certificate as a school counselor to have obtained training in, by a method determined by the Board, the knowledge and skills required to understand and respond to the social, emotional, and personal development of students, including knowledge and skills relating to:

    • (1) The recognition of indicators of mental illness and behavioral distress, including depression, trauma, violence, youth suicide, and substance abuse; and

    • (2) The identification of professional resources to help students in crisis.

  • (b) Training may exceed training required of other personnel. -- The training required under subsection (a) of this section shall be commensurate with the duties of a school counselor and may exceed the training required of other school personnel under ยง 6-122 of this title.

  • (c) Regulations. -- The Board shall adopt regulations to implement the provisions of this section.
